The local kayak club was able to arrange for Wayne Horodovich to teach two sessions of his "The Art of Staying Upright" class at Chatfield SP on July 15th & 22nd. I made it to the class on the 22nd.

Three hours on the water with one of my idols of sea kayaking was worth every penny paid.

Lessons Learned:

1. Looking at the paddle blade really does help enforce torso rotation.

2. Rescues, in real life, are done a bit differently. Pulling up along side a capsized paddler is an amazingly simple and effective rescue when practiced.

3. Moving the paddle blade forward or back during the brace, rather than slapping it, is way more effective. This was reinforcement of what I learned at my first Lumpy Waters during the surf classes.
